- Résumé : Will she manage to find the perfect balance? Charlène is starting to adjust to her new life, far from Brussels and the past she left behind. The recent tragedy at her factory pushes her to seek a job that suits her better. Her relationship with Hugo is also transforming her, bringing a smile back to her face. But all these changes are happening very quickly. Are they truly ready to build a future together? Will her daughters accept it? Delia Wilmus delivers a refreshing novel filled with warmth and emotional depth — a feel-good read that lifts your spirits!
